winter wonderland. This time last week we were well on our way to having about a FOOT of snow here in Atlanta! It was such an unexpected surprise and, let me tell you, it was so SO beautiful. G and I were both allowed to leave work early, so we met up at home, bundled up and went for a walk around the neighborhood. I had NEVER seen weather like this before – let alone having it in our own backyard! I wore my favorite maternity jeans, a long sleeve white top, quilted vest (non-maternity here) and gray coat. I’ve also had these Hunter boots for a couple of years now and can’t tell you how great they are – especially for trekking through snow. Gracie LOVED the snow. She chased after snowballs and tried to catch them in her mouth 😉
